Sarnath's Sacred Sites: Monuments to Buddha's Teachings
Nestled in the tranquil embrace of the Ganges Valley, Sarnath stands as a testament to the profound influence of Lord Buddha. This hallowed site preserves within its boundaries several sacred structures that reiterate the essence of his teachings.
Among these, the website Dhamekh Stupa, a majestic edifice crowned with a ornate dome, commemorates the spot where Buddha first shared his wisdom of enlightenment after achieving nirvana. The Mulagandha Kuti Vihara, a historic monastery, represents a replica of Buddha's original hermitage where he dwelt in solitude and contemplation.
- Additionally, the Sarnath Museum displays an rich collection of Buddhist relics that offer a glimpse into the development of Buddhism through the centuries.
